    1. Material

    It's important to know what kind of leather couches clearance is used when buying an leather sofa. Full grain leather is a premium choice because it's beautiful and durable. However, it's also much more expensive than top grain leather. Top grain leather is made from the top layer of the hide that has been polished and sanded to eliminate imperfections. It's a great choice for those who do not want to pay the cost of full grain leather but still want a soft and durable material.

    An aniline dyed leather that is protected is an alternative. It's a lesser-cost alternative, but it's not as durable than top-grain or full-grain leather. It's stain resistant and can be cleaned with a damp cloth. It's a great choice for families with children and pets.

    The corrected or pigmented grain leather is a budget-friendly option that's typically utilized in mid-range and low-end sofas. The material is treated to stop it from becoming faded. It's a good option for furniture that is light colored or for those who don't want to deal with the maintenance of a full grain or top grain leather.

    4. Warranty

    The top leather sofas leather typically come with a warranty, but the quality of this warranty is a major factor to consider. A good leather couch warranty should cover the frame and spring support system, as well as the workmanship of the material, such as buttons tufting, upholstery seams, cushion zippers, etc. Most furniture retailers offer a warranty for sofas, but you should take note of the fine print.

    The majority of furniture manufacturers offer a limited warranty that extends to a lifetime for the frame, suspension and the fabric. Certain furniture companies might provide a longer warranty on certain components, like springs or recline mechanisms. The duration of the warranty is to be stated on the product's page and a clear description of the warranty's coverage can be found in the company's terms and conditions.
